Patent number: 4581283Abstract: Heat-sensitive magnetic transfer element for printing magnetic image to be recognized by magnetic ink character reader (MICR), which comprises a heat-resisting foundation and a heat-sensitive transferring layer provided on the foundation, said transferring layer having a melting temperature of 50.degree. to 120.degree. C. and comprising 30 to 97% by weight of a ferromagnetic substance powder, 2 to 69% by weight of a wax and 1 to 68% by weight of a resin. The transfer element gives a printed magnetic image having high accuracy of dimensions and high magnetic properties by thermal printing method.Type: GrantFiled: May 17, 1984Date of Patent: April 8, 1986Assignees: Nippon Telegraph & Telephone Public Corporation, Fuji Kagakushi Kogyo Co., Ltd.Inventors: Yukio Tokunaga, Yasuhisa Ikeda, Tadao Seto, Yoshikazu Shimazaki

Patent number: 4474844Abstract: A heat transfer recording medium which comprises tissue paper having thereon an ink layer comprised of material fluidizable or sublimatable upon the application of heat. The tissue paper has a thickness of 5 to 25 .mu.m, a density of 0.8 to 1.45 g/cm.sup.3, a smoothness of 200 to 20,000 seconds (determined by the Oken type measurement) and a water content adjusted to 6 to 13 wt % after forming the ink layer thereon. The medium does not generate puckers when employed in a transfer type heat sensitive recording apparatus under high temperature and humidity conditions.Type: GrantFiled: December 20, 1982Date of Patent: October 2, 1984Assignees: Fuji Xerox Co., Ltd., Fuji Kagakushi Kogyo Co., Ltd.Inventors: Takashi Omori, Haruhiko Moriguchi, Tadao Seto, Yoshikazu Shimazaki, Hiromitsu Matsuba, Toshiharu Inui
